Why Compliance Matters in Apparel Export
Compliance with international regulations is critical for apparel manufacturers looking to export their products. This guide will help you navigate the complex landscape of compliance in the global apparel market.
Understanding Import Regulations
Each country has its own import regulations affecting how apparel can be exported. Manufacturers must thoroughly research the requirements of their target markets.
Quality Standards and Certification
Many regions require specific quality standards and certifications for apparel products. Ensuring compliance can enhance a brand's reputation and reduce the risk of returns.
Environmental Regulations
With sustainability becoming a focus globally, manufacturers must comply with environmental regulations that govern production practices.
Intellectual Property Rights
Protecting intellectual property is crucial when entering international markets. Manufacturers should register trademarks and understand copyright laws in their target regions.
Trade Agreements and Tariffs
Understanding trade agreements and tariffs between countries can significantly affect pricing and competitiveness. Manufacturers should stay informed about changes that may arise.
Conclusion
Navigating compliance regulations can be complex, but by staying informed and proactive, apparel manufacturers can successfully export their products while minimizing risks.
